Spring Cloud Hystrix ThreadPool的bug

简介: Spring Cloud Hystrix ThreadPool的bug

BUG背景


JDK: 11.0.4 Spring Cloud Finchley.SR3

相关配置:

#开启hystrix
feign.hystrix.enabled=true
#关闭断路器
hystrix.command.default.circuitBreaker.enabled=false
#禁用hystrix远程调用超时时间
hystrix.command.default.execution.timeout.enabled=false
hystrix.threadpool.default.coreSize=50

Hystrix隔离策略:线程隔离

在Feign调用的时候,会报错:

Caused by: java.lang.IllegalArgumentException
        at java.util.concurrent.ThreadPoolExecutor.setCorePoolSize(ThreadPoolExecutor.java:1535) ~[?:?]
        at com.netflix.hystrix.HystrixThreadPool$HystrixThreadPoolDefault.touchConfig(HystrixThreadPool.java:230) ~[hystrix-core-1.5.18.jar!/:1.5.18]

重启有时候复现,有时候不复现,估计是和类加载还有初始化顺序有关的问题。


问题定位


查看问题源代码, 对于每个微服务调用,初始化Hytrix线程池,动态读取配置:

private void touchConfig() {
    final int dynamicCoreSize = properties.coreSize().get();
    final int configuredMaximumSize = properties.maximumSize().get();
    int dynamicMaximumSize = properties.actualMaximumSize();
    final boolean allowSizesToDiverge = properties.getAllowMaximumSizeToDivergeFromCoreSize().get();
    boolean maxTooLow = false;
    if (allowSizesToDiverge && configuredMaximumSize < dynamicCoreSize) {
        //if user sets maximum < core (or defaults get us there), we need to maintain invariant of core <= maximum
        dynamicMaximumSize = dynamicCoreSize;
        maxTooLow = true;
    }
    // In JDK 6, setCorePoolSize and setMaximumPoolSize will execute a lock operation. Avoid them if the pool size is not changed.
    if (threadPool.getCorePoolSize() != dynamicCoreSize || (allowSizesToDiverge && threadPool.getMaximumPoolSize() != dynamicMaximumSize)) {
        if (maxTooLow) {
            logger.error("Hystrix ThreadPool configuration for : " + metrics.getThreadPoolKey().name() + " is trying to set coreSize = " +
                    dynamicCoreSize + " and maximumSize = " + configuredMaximumSize + ".  Maximum size will be set to " +
                    dynamicMaximumSize + ", the coreSize value, since it must be equal to or greater than the coreSize value");
        }
        threadPool.setCorePoolSize(dynamicCoreSize);
        threadPool.setMaximumPoolSize(dynamicMaximumSize);
    }
    threadPool.setKeepAliveTime(properties.keepAliveTimeMinutes().get(), TimeUnit.MINUTES);
}

报错是在threadPool.setCorePoolSize(dynamicCoreSize);,看下为何:

public void setCorePoolSize(int corePoolSize) {
        if (corePoolSize < 0 || maximumPoolSize < corePoolSize)
            throw new IllegalArgumentException();
    //忽略其他代码
}

发现还有maximumPoolSize < corePoolSize的判断,所以,需要先设置MaximumPoolSize,之后设置CorePoolSize,这样可以避免这个问题


相关ISSUES与解决方案


看了下社区,已经有ISSUE了:https://github.com/Netflix/Hystrix/issues/1874 还有对应的PULL REQUEST:https://github.com/Netflix/Hystrix/pull/1877

但是目前,还没有合并,只好自己改了,项目中增加同名同路径替换类,修改:

//jdk9以上的版本,设置coreSize会验证coreSize必须小于maxSize,所以先改变max再设置core
                threadPool.setMaximumPoolSize(dynamicMaximumSize);
                threadPool.setCorePoolSize(dynamicCoreSize);
